Deeply Toned 1858 Seated Dollar--A Rare, Proof-Only Issue

1858 PR 65. A third example of this (normally) rare proof Seated dollar. The fields on this gem are brightly reflective and both sides are covered with speckled golden-rose patina in the centers with blue margins. There are no mentionable defects on either side of this lovely and important proof-only dollar. From the Riverly Collection.
Ex: Bangs (unlisted in Adams), 2/16/1882; John Work Garrett (Stack's, 3/76), lot 276.

Coin Index Numbers: (NGC ID# 252C, PCGS# 7001, Greysheet# 7298)

Metal: 90% Silver, 10% Copper
Weight: 26.73 grams
ASW: 0.85oz
Mintage: 210
